Small Business Finance 101: Building a Solid Budget

Embarking into the world of small business ownership is an exciting journey. Though, it's essential to lay a strong foundation for its financial success. Budgeting, a cornerstone of sound financial planning, provides a roadmap for allocating resources effectively and securing your business goals. A well-crafted budget not only measures your income and expenses but also helps you in making informed selections regarding investments, outlays, and growth strategies.

  • Consider| a look at some budgeting basics to get you started:

1. Calculate Your Income: Precisely assess your revenue streams, such as sales, services, and any other income sources.

2. Classify Your Expenses: List all your business expenses, categorizing them into categories such as rent, utilities, salaries, marketing, and inventory. 3. Define Realistic Goals: Outline your financial objectives for the budgeting period, whether it's increasing profitability, lowering debt, or expanding operations.

4. Track Your Progress: Regularly assess your budget performance, comparing actual expenses to your projections. Amend your budget as needed to stay on track and achieve your goals.
